Keep Alive As mentioned above, the use of usernames instead of phone numbers means your account isnβt tied to just one phone. This makes it easier to log in on other devices, allows you to have multiple accounts on the same device, and makes it so you donβt have to share your phone number with someone to add them as a contact in Telegram. If you like to customize your favorite chats, there is a good chance that you would appreciate custom sounds. What makes it so handy is the ability to let you set any short audio clip from a chat as a notification sound. It will make it a bit more convenient for you to identify the alerts from a specific Telegram chat. Keep in mind that the audio clip must be less than 5 seconds and up to 300KB in size. With Telegram, you can send thousands of high-quality stickers right from the chatbox. Just tap the βsticker iconβ on the left bottom, and it will show you dozens of trending stickers and masks.
